41namespace gem5
42{
43
44namespace
45{
46
47class LinuxLoader : public Process::Loader
48{
49 public:
50 Process *
51 load(const ProcessParams &params, loader::ObjectFile *obj) override
52 {
53 if (obj->getArch() != loader::Mips)
54 return nullptr;
55
56 auto opsys = obj->getOpSys();
57
58 if (opsys == loader::UnknownOpSys) {
59 warn("Unknown operating system; assuming Linux.");
60 opsys = loader::Linux;
61 }
62
63 if (opsys != loader::Linux)
64 return nullptr;
65
66 return new MipsProcess(params, obj);
67 }
68};
69
70LinuxLoader linuxLoader;
71
72} // anonymous namespace
73
74namespace MipsISA
75{
76
77void
79{
80 Process *process = tc->getProcessPtr();
81 // Call the syscall function in the base Process class to update stats.
82 // This will move into the base SEWorkload function at some point.
83 process->Process::syscall(tc);
84
86}
87
89static SyscallReturn
91{
92 auto process = tc->getProcessPtr();
93
94 strcpy(name->sysname, "Linux");
95 strcpy(name->nodename,"sim.gem5.org");
96 strcpy(name->release, process->release.c_str());
97 strcpy(name->version, "#1 Mon Aug 18 11:32:15 EDT 2003");
98 strcpy(name->machine, "mips");
99
100 return 0;
101}
102
106static SyscallReturn
108 unsigned bufPtr, unsigned nbytes)
109{
110 switch (op) {
111 case 45:
112 {
113 // GSI_IEEE_FP_CONTROL
114 VPtr<uint64_t> fpcr(bufPtr, tc);
115 // I don't think this exactly matches the HW FPCR
116 *fpcr = 0;
117 return 0;
118 }
119 default:
120 std::cerr << "sys_getsysinfo: unknown op " << op << std::endl;
121 abort();
122 break;
123 }
124
125 return 1;
126}
127
129static SyscallReturn
131 VPtr<> bufPtr, unsigned nbytes)
132{
133 switch (op) {
134
135 case 14:
136 {
137 // SSI_IEEE_FP_CONTROL
138 ConstVPtr<uint64_t> fpcr(bufPtr, tc);
139 // I don't think this exactly matches the HW FPCR
140 DPRINTFR(SyscallVerbose, "sys_setsysinfo(SSI_IEEE_FP_CONTROL): "
141 " setting FPCR to 0x%x\n", letoh(*fpcr));
142 return 0;
143 }
144 default:
145 std::cerr << "sys_setsysinfo: unknown op " << op << std::endl;
146 abort();
147 break;
148 }
149
150 return 1;
151}
152
153static SyscallReturn
155{
157 return 0;
158}
